The Irish Co-operative Organisation Society Ltd
2016-05-20
Intent: ICOS presented a taxation proposal aimed at alleviating the impact of dairy market volatility on farmer income. The measure seeks to improve the current 5 year income averaging system, by also permitting a farmer to defer 5% of his income in a good year, in order to draw down the deferred income when markets are in difficultly. In any case, the farmer would have to draw down his/her deferred income within 5 years.
Details: ICOS '555' Income Stability Tool
Officials: Simon Coveney, Aidan O'Driscoll, Brendan Gleeson, Ann Derwin
Methods: Initial letter and table sent on 11 January 2016. - Letter, Dairy Forum on 09 March 2016. - Meeting, Dairy Forum Sub Group on 11 April 2016. - Meeting
